Explain the safety procedures you follow before starting a bogger.
- Answer: Before starting any bogger, I always conduct a thorough pre-operational inspection, checking fluid levels (hydraulic fluid, engine oil, coolant), tire pressure (if applicable), brakes, lights, and all safety systems. I ensure all guards and safety devices are in place and functioning correctly. I check the surrounding area for any obstructions or hazards, and I communicate with other personnel on-site to ensure a safe working environment. I always wear the appropriate personal protective equipment (PPE), including hard hats, safety glasses, and high-visibility clothing.

How do you maintain the bogger's optimal performance?
- Answer: Maintaining optimal performance involves regular maintenance checks, including daily lubrication, fluid level checks, and visual inspections for wear and tear. I follow the manufacturer's recommended maintenance schedule and promptly report any unusual noises, leaks, or performance issues to my supervisor. Proper cleaning after each use is also crucial to prevent corrosion and damage.

What are the common causes of bogger malfunctions and how do you troubleshoot them?
- Answer: Common malfunctions include hydraulic leaks, engine problems, electrical faults, and mechanical failures. Troubleshooting involves systematically checking each system, starting with the most likely cause based on the symptoms. I use diagnostic tools, consult manuals, and utilize my experience to identify and rectify problems. If I'm unable to solve the issue, I immediately report it to my supervisor.
